mysql A表包含的列 人员id ,姓名和B表的列 地址id,人员id,城市,州。求人的姓名,城市和州。人员id如果不在B表报告null
select a.姓名,b.城市,b.州
from a
left join b
on a.人员id=b.人员id;
解释
左连接的意思就是保留左表的全部数据,如果右表有空数据返回null
右连接的表示保留右表的全部数据,如果左表右空数据返回null
select a.姓名,b.城市,b.州
from a
left join b
on a.人员id=b.人员id;
解释
左连接的意思就是保留左表的全部数据,如果右表有空数据返回null
右连接的表示保留右表的全部数据,如果左表右空数据返回null